Masayoshi Son, the CEO of Softbank Group Corp (OTC: SFTBF) (OTC: SFTBY), emphasized the transformative power of artificial general intelligence (AGI) during the company’s annual SoftBank World event.
He asserted that AGI would outstrip human intelligence within a decade, urging businesses to embrace this technology or risk obsolescence, the Wall Street Journal reports.
Son’s advocacy for AGI comes when a global race spearheaded by tech giants like Meta Platforms Inc (NASDAQ: META) and Alphabet Inc (NASDAQ: GOOG) (NASDAQ: GOOGL), aiming to harness AI’s potential to revolutionize professional and personal landscapes.
